Abstract

One of the things you’ll soon appreciate on your netbook is the ability to do your work anywhere. This is especially true for 10-inch models, which have keyboards large enough for most hands to use without much trouble. An important aspect of most people’s work is creating office documents. Ubuntu Netbook Remix comes with the office suite OpenOffice.org. In this chapter, you’ll get an introduction to using this office suite. The following topics are covered:

  • Exploring OpenOffice.org

  • Ensuring compatibility with Microsoft Office

  • Becoming familiar with specific OpenOffice.org features
